Drops of health – Vitamin B
Women with higher intakes of vitamin B6, whether from food or vitamin supplements, may be less likely to develop cancer of the colon or rectum, according to a study from Harvard Medical School. Further tests are needed to confirm the result, but the findings are promising. For one thing, other public health studies have found a similar association between vitamin B6 and colorectal cancer. And laboratory research has shown that high levels of vitamin B6 can suppress cancer in human and animal cells.
